关于S7-200 CPU和模块的通信端口引脚定义,详情请参考《S7-200系统手册》。
在这里只是列出了一些需要注意,或者用户感兴趣的要点。
表1. S7-200 CPU通信口引脚定义:
CPU插座(9针母头) | 引脚号 | PROFIBUS名称 | Port0/Port1(端口0/端口1)引脚定义 |
---|---|---|---|
1 | 屏蔽 | 机壳接地(与端子PE相同)/屏蔽 | |
2 | 24V返回 | 逻辑地(24V公共端) | |
3 | RS-485信号 B | RS-485信号 B 或 TxD/RxD + | |
4 | 发送请求 | RTS(TTL) | |
5 | 5V返回 | 逻辑地(5V公共端) | |
6 | +5V | +5V,通过100 Ohm电阻 | |
7 | +24V | +24V | |
8 | RS-485信号 A | RS-485信号 A 或 TxD/RxD - | |
9 | 不用 | 10位协议选择(输入) | |
金属壳 | 屏蔽 | 机壳接地(与端子PE相同)/与电缆屏蔽层连通 |
上表中,3和8为RS-485信号,它们的背景颜色与PROFIBUS电缆、PROFIBUS网络插头上的颜色标记一致。通信端口可以从2和7向外供24V直流电源。
注意:
表2. EM277通信口
EM277插座(9针母头) | 引脚号 | PROFIBUS名称 | 引脚定义 |
---|---|---|---|
1 | 屏蔽 | 机壳接地,连接插头外壳/屏蔽 | |
2 | 24V返回 | 24V返回,与模块端子M相通 | |
3 | RS-485信号 B | 隔离的RS-485信号 B 或 TxD/RxD + | |
4 | 发送请求 | 隔离的RTS(发送请求,TTL电平) | |
5 | 5V返回 | 隔离的5V返回 | |
6 | +5V | 隔离的+5V电源(最大电流90mA) | |
7 | +24V | +24V电源,来自模块端子L+(最大电流120mA,带反向保护二极管) | |
8 | RS-485信号 A | 隔离的RS-485信号 A 或 TxD/RxD - | |
9 | 不用 | 不用 | |
金属壳 | 屏蔽 | 机壳接地(与引脚1相通)/可与电缆屏蔽层连通 |
使用PROFIBUS网络插头时,连接器外壳与PROFIBUS电缆的屏蔽层相通。EM277插头上的24V电源从模块端子L+/M来。
EM277通信口具有优异的通信能力,其主要原因是它的RS-485信号是隔离的。在情况复杂通信受到影响时,可以使用EM277连接操作面板(其他品牌的HMI须咨询其生产商)。
关于PC/PPI电缆的详细情况,请参考相应的《S7-200系统手册》,在附录A中由详细的介绍。这里只提示关于电缆的一些有趣的细节。
目前销售的RS-232/PPI多主站电缆(6ES7 901-3CB30-0XA0)与以前销售的PC/PPI电缆(6ES7 901-3BF21-0XA0)略有区别,比较如下:
表3. RS-232/PPI多主站电缆
RS-485侧插头 | RS-485侧插头引脚定义 | RS-232侧插头引脚定义(本地模式)1 | RS-232侧插头引脚定义(远程模式)1 |
---|---|---|---|
1 | 未连接 | 数据载波检测(DCD)(不用) | |
2 | 24V返回(RS-485逻辑地) | 接收数据(RD)(从电缆输出) | 接收数据(RD)(输入到电缆) |
3 | RS-485信号B(RxD/TxD+) | 传送数据(TD)(输入到电缆) | 传送数据(TD)(从电缆输出) |
4 | RTS(TTL电平) | 数据终端就绪(DTR) | |
5 | 未连接 | 地(RS-232逻辑地) | 地(RS-232逻辑地) |
6 | 未连接 | 数据设置就绪(DSR) | |
7 | 24V电源 | 发送请求(RTS)(不用) | 发送请求(RTS)(从电缆输出)2 |
8 | RS-485信号A(RxD/TxD-) | 清除发送(CTS)(不用) | |
9 | 协议选择 | 振铃指示(RI)(不用) |
此电缆的RS-232端,4针和6针始终连通,即DTR/DSR是短接的。
表4. PC/PPI电缆(3BF21)
RS-485侧插头 | RS-485侧插头引脚定义 | RS-232侧插头引脚定义(DCE模式)1 | RS-232侧插头引脚定义(DTE模式)1 |
---|---|---|---|
1 | 插头外壳(PE) | 数据载波检测(DCD)(不用) | |
2 | 24V返回(RS-485逻辑地) | 接收数据(RD)(从电缆输出) | 接收数据(RD)(输入到电缆) |
3 | RS-485信号B(RxD/TxD+) | 传送数据(TD)(输入到电缆) | 传送数据(TD)(从电缆输出) |
4 | RTS(TTL电平) | 数据终端就绪(DTR)(不用) | |
5 | ? | 地(RS-232逻辑地) | 地(RS-232逻辑地) |
6 | 未连接 | 数据设置就绪(DSR)(不用) | |
7 | 24V电源 | 发送请求(RTS)(不用) | 发送请求(RTS)(从电缆输出)2 |
8 | RS-485信号A(RxD/TxD-) | 清除发送(CTS)(不用) | |
9 | 协议选择 | 振铃指示(RI)(不用) |
上述的“本地”模式相当于“DCE”模式;“远程”模式相当于“DTE”模式。
所谓DTE和DCE是RS-232通信中的一对设备,参见PC/PPI电缆的DTE/DCE设置。